marine and aircraft susceptability to cell phone emissions
Like a person before ho cerfied avionics for use, I design and manufacture avionics displays for military use as well as marine displays.
In all my years of doing this there has been only one anectdotal report of possible interference in mid cabin on a commericial aircraft right on a window seat. Despite followup tests this was never confirmed. In marine displays there are restrictions about the placement of emitting equipment near the radio which is in the vhf band but these are international standards not US. In short there is no documented proof of any interference by cell phones to any aircraft/marine system. BTW gps terminals are not banned for use, simply because they are receivers and not transmitters.
